Default DL Letter Template

Hello,
I have created a very basic template for our letters that we send out. It is
A4 that folds DL.
At the very top I have created a Header with the company logo and return
address.
Below that, I have carefully lined up where the Sending Address goes to.
Which I just highlight and retype the address as needed.
I was wondering though, is it possible to create a permanent block, field,
area that just stays there. So, when I open the letter, all I have to do is
click in the space and it will delete the information and I can type the
current address. Then when I am finished just move on to the body of the
letter?
I do look forward anyones assistance on this matter.

Thank you.

You might try http://word.mvps.org/FAQs/TblsFldsFm...acroButton.htm. If
you need the address block to remain the same size regardless of content,
put it in a borderless table cell with Exact row height.

Be sure you put your letterhead in the page header; if you put the date
there as well, then your insertion point will be in the address field when
you create a new document based on this template; see
http://sbarnhill.mvps.org/WordFAQs/Letterhead.htm
